> Mail downloads have been consistently aborting after longer messages
> before Insight gives the command to display  a new index. Today I
> came back from a long weekend and had 19 messages. Insight aborted at
> least seven times before I got through all 19. Several of the emails
> came up missing from the index and could not be found. I knew they
> had been there waiting on the server bcause I had read them previously
> through a webmail interface that my ISP offers.

> I don't think this is any better than before when Insight would
> "choke" on malformed emails and you couldn't get past thenm without
> telnet or webmail or another email client that wouldn't choke.

> Insight is not forming a proper index of downloaded emails when it
> aborts and it is not always leaving the email on the server for a second
> attempt.

First-off:

Insight.exe does NOT download your email... core.exe does it.
http://www.cisnet.com/glennmcc/ara-gpl/core-ins.txt

Second:

http://www.cisnet.com/glennmcc/arachne/
(updated on May 5, 2006 with 2 small bug fixes)
a190core.zip(pop3 abort fix in updated core.exe)
^^^^^^^^^^^^<---link to updated core.exe which fixes the mail
download abort problems.
